The Appeal of Sports Betting with Bovada

Sports betting remains a core component of the platform’s attraction. The breadth of sports covered is extensive, extending beyond mainstream favorites to include international events and even eSports. The platform offers various betting formats, including moneyline bets (simply picking the winner), spread bets (betting on a team to win by a certain margin), over/under bets (predicting whether the total score will be over or under a specified number), and parlays (combining multiple bets into a single wager for a higher potential payout). The platform also provides live streaming of select events, allowing users to watch the action unfold while simultaneously placing bets. This enhances the overall viewing experience and provides real-time insights that can inform betting decisions. The interface is designed to be intuitive, even for those new to sports betting, with clear odds displays and easy-to-navigate menus.

Exploring Casino Games and Poker Options

Beyond sports betting, offers a robust casino section that caters to a wide range of preferences. The slot game selection is particularly extensive, featuring both classic three-reel slots and modern video slots with elaborate themes and bonus features. Table game enthusiasts can find variations of bl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and craps. The availability of live dealer games, where players interact with a real dealer via video stream, adds a touch of authenticity to the online casino experience. The poker room is another significant attraction, offering Texas Hold'em, Omaha, and Stud games in various formats, including cash games, tournaments, and sit-and-go's. The platform utilizes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ure the fairness and randomness of all casino games, and these RNGs are regularly audited by independent testing agencies.

Successfully navigating the casino and poker sections requires a different skillset than sports betting. For slots, understanding the payout percentages (RTP – Return to Player) and volatility levels can help players make informed decisions. For table games, mastering basic strategy is crucial for minimizing the house edge. In poker, developing strong hand reading skills, understanding position, and managing bankroll are essential for success. Security Measures and Responsible Gaming Initiatives

Security is paramount for any online platform handling financial transactions and personal data, and bovada invests significantly in maintaining robust security measures. These measures include SSL encryption to protect data transmission, multi-factor authentication for enhanced account security, and regular security audits to identify and address vulnerabilities. The platform also employs fraud detection systems to monitor transactions and prevent unauthorized access. However, users also have a responsibility to protect their own accounts by using strong, unique passwords, enabling two-factor authentication, and being wary of phishing attempts. Report any suspicious activity to the platform’s support team immediately. It’s also crucial to ensure your device is protected with up-to-date antivirus software and a firewall.

In addition to security, responsible gaming is a critical aspect of the platform’s ethos. Recognizing the potential for problem gambling, provides a range of tools and resources to help users manage their gaming habits. These include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and links to organizations that provide support for problem gamblers. Users can set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its to control their spending. Self-exclusion allows users to temporarily or permanently block themselves from accessing the platform. The platform also provides educational materials on responsible gaming, including tips on recognizing the signs of problem gambling and seeking help when needed.
